Claimant, a truck driver for the employer, had been laid off since 1982 and was thereafter called in to work on an as-needed basis. Pursuant to an employment contract, claimant was allowed to refuse a call to work; if he accepted, however, he had to report to the employer's terminal facility within two hours.
